This was in i-news and basically it’s a report that says the menopause is affected by the culture we live in. What we think and even how many hot flushes we have, can be governed by how we think about it. In Japan, menopausal women don’t take HRT, neither do they have as many hot flushes as we do in the UK. And their translation of menopause is season of renewal! Quite.

Eery? Wonderful? This is Tracey Emin as Frida Kahlo by Mary McCartney at the National Portrait Gallery. ·
‘Emin is photographed in the style of fellow artist Frida Kahlo.
Growing up in Margate, Kent, Emin went on to study at the Royal College of Art, before rising to prominence as one of the YBAs (Young British Artists) in the late 1980s. Her work is celebrated for its exploration of deeply personal experiences with both vulnerability and confrontation, across a wide range of media.’
